Transmission is designed for easy, powerful use. Transmission has the features you want from a BitTorrent client: encryption, a web interface, peer exchange, magnet links, DHT, µTP, UPnP and NAT-PMP port forwarding, webseed support, watch directories, tracker editing, global and per-torrent speed limits, and more. ## Parameters
|
||||
|
||||
`The parameters are split into two halves, separated by a colon, the left hand side representing the host and the right the container side.
|
||||
For example with a port -p external:internal - what this shows is the port mapping from internal to external of the container.
|
||||
So -p 8080:80 would expose port 80 from inside the container to be accessible from the host's IP on port 8080
|
||||
http://192.168.x.x:8080 would show you what's running INSIDE the container on port 80.`

Webui is on port 9091, the settings.json file in /config has extra settings not available in the webui. Stop the container before editing it or any changes won't be saved.
|
||||
|
||||
## Securing the webui with a username/password.
|
||||
|
||||
this requires 3 settings to be changed in the settings.json file.
|
||||
|
||||
`Make sure the container is stopped before editing these settings.`
|
||||
|
||||
`"rpc-authentication-required": true,` - check this, the default is false, change to true.
|
||||
|
||||
`"rpc-username": "transmission",` substitute transmission for your chosen user name, this is just an example.
|
||||
|
||||
`rpc-password` will be a hash starting with {, replace everything including the { with your chosen password, keeping the quotes.
|
||||
|
||||
Transmission will convert it to a hash when you restart the container after making the above edits.

## Updating Blocklists Automatically
|
||||
|
||||
This requires `"blocklist-enabled": true,` to be set. By setting this to true, it is assumed you have also populated `blocklist-url` with a valid block list.
|
||||
|
||||
The automatic update is a shell script that downloads a blocklist from the url stored in the settings.json, gunzips it, and restarts the transmission daemon.
|
||||
|
||||
The automatic update will run once a day at 3am local server time.

## Info
|
||||
|
||||
* To monitor the logs of the container in realtime `docker logs -f transmission`.
|
||||
|
||||
* container version number
|
||||
|
||||
`docker inspect -f '{{ index .Config.Labels "build_version" }}' transmission`
|
||||
|
||||
* image version number
|
||||
|
||||
`docker inspect -f '{{ index .Config.Labels "build_version" }}' linuxserver/transmission`
